Travel from Yamuna Bank to Tilak Nagar on a direct Delhi Metro service with no interchange required. The journey covers 19 stations over approximately 18.48 km. A token fare is ₹43, while smart card users pay ₹39. Trains run from 05:53 AM to 11:35 PM, about every 4–6 minutes.

Yamuna Bank to Tilak Nagar runs on the Blue Main Line (Dwarka - Noida) of Delhi Metro. The journey takes about 42 minutes across 19 stations.
No interchanges on this route. Trains run daily from 05:53 AM to 11:35 PM, every 4–6 minutes.
Token fare: ₹43 · Smart Card fare: ₹39.
Yamuna Bank, Indraprastha, Supreme Court, Mandi House, Barakhamba Road, Rajiv Chowk, Ramakrishna Ashram Marg, Jhandewalan, Karol Bagh, Rajendra Place, Patel Nagar, Shadipur, Kirti Nagar, Moti Nagar, Ramesh Nagar, Rajouri Garden, Tagore Garden, Subhash Nagar, Tilak Nagar
